Output 3264576911201fb9164e6bd8065ef8ac34723ab529743af20e8ef7fd7d2bbbd6:1

value
25096460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9000ab1f335aad2f97d11b5187e2d99f19294592 OP_EQUAL
address
3EpS2cRznczYqVL3uAoSHaiqRn8FKqWepa
transaction
3264576911201fb9164e6bd8065ef8ac34723ab529743af20e8ef7fd7d2bbbd6
spent
true